Eclipse [hawkBit](https://projects.eclipse.org/projects/iot.hawkbit) is an domain independent back end solution for rolling out software updates to constrained edge devices as well as more powerful controllers and gateways connected to IP based networking infrastructure.

# Releases and Roadmap
* We are currently working on the first formal release under the Eclipse banner: 0.1 (see [Release 0.1 branch](https://github.com/eclipse/hawkbit/tree/release-train-0.1)).
* The master branch contains future development towards 0.2. We are currently focusing on:
* Rollout Management for large scale rollouts.
* In the upcoming release [0.2](https://github.com/eclipse/hawkbit/issues/390):
* Rollout management for large scale update campaigns.
* Clustering capabilities for the update server.
* Upgrade of Spring Boot and Vaadin dependencies.
* And of course tons of usability improvements and bug fixes.
* Upgrade of Spring Boot and Vaadin dependencies (Boot 1.4, Vaadin 7.7).
* Improvements on modularization and customizability based on Spring's auto-configuration mechanism.
* Provide Spring Boot Starters for custom apps based on hawkBit.
* Provide standard runtime by means of Spring Boot based hawkBit update server (and hopefully a docker image).
* And of course tons of usability improvements and bug fixes.
* Future releases
* Complete repository refactoring.
* Integrate with Eclipse hono as DMF provider.
* Flexible DMF messaging infrastructure (e.g. with Spring Cloud Stream).
* Migrate to Spring Framework 5, Spring Boot 2 and Vaadin 8
* Re-evaluate JPA as persistence provider (e.g. look into jOOQ)
